Flat-leaved scalewort
Flat-leaved scalewort is a liverwort, a non-vascular land plant. It often forms dense, flattened, green mats resembling lichens but thrives in moist, shaded environments. With narrow, overlapping leaves, flat-leaved scalewort clings to tree bark or rocks, showcasing its resilience against harsh conditions and making it distinctive from mosses to which it's sometimes likened.
